Addit! Pro For Flight Simulator 2002
I see a dialog that says, "The feature you are trying to use is on a
network resource that is unavailable" or "Error 1706. No valid source could be
found for product Addit! Pro For Flight Simulator 2002". What should I do?
NOTE: Substitute 2002 for 2004 in all places below.
If a critical part of Addit! Pro is missing or corrupt or if you pick the
"Repair Addit! Pro For Flight Simulator 2004" option, the Windows Installer
looks for a file called apfs2004.msi. This msi file is a Microsoft
Windows Installer data file and it works much like a zip file in that it contains other
files needed by Windows Installer. If apfs2004.msi cannot be located,
Windows Installer raises this error:
The feature you are trying to use is on a network resource that is
unavailable.
Click OK to try again, or enter an alternate path to a folder containing the installation
package 'apfs2004.msi' in the box below.
Use feature from:
D:\Documents and Settings\[Your Windows Account Name]\Local Settings\Temp\install\
Follow these steps to make apfs2004.msi available to Windows Installer so it can complete
successfully:
1. Download the latest version of Addit! Pro For Flight Simulator 2004 from http://www.byteforge.com/products/ap_fs2004/download/index.htm.
2. Extract the file apfs2004.msi from the zip file you downloaded in step
#1.
3. Place apfs2004.msi in the folder mentioned by the Windows Installer
(for example, "D:\Documents and Settings\[Your Windows Account Name]\Local
Settings\Temp\install\".
Now try again. Windows Installer will locate the file and update Addit! Pro automatically.
